Legend Capital

Legend Capital, established in 2001, is a Beijing-based venture capital firm and subsidiary of Legend Holdings Ltd. It manages multiple funds totaling up to US$700 million, focusing on early-stage IT companies and mid-market growth stage companies in China. Its investment sectors include network applications and services, outsourcing, professional services, IC design, key components, consumer goods, clean technology, healthcare, and modern services. Legend Capital actively supports its portfolio companies, providing business resources and tailored services to facilitate growth and enhance returns. Notable portfolio companies include Joyo.com (acquired by Amazon.com) and Spreadtrum Communications (Nasdaq: SPRD).

Past deals in Beijing

DeepWise

Venture Round in 2025
Beijing DeepWise Science and Technology Co., Ltd. specializes in artificial intelligence-based medical application software aimed at enhancing clinical imaging analysis and diagnostics.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Beijing, the company focuses on the early screening and diagnosis of various malignant diseases, including lung and breast cancer. It serves a diverse clientele, including hospitals, medical centers, and third-party imaging facilities. DeepWise's innovative software leverages advanced technology to improve diagnostic accuracy and efficiency, facilitating online consultations and data analysis through cloud-based solutions. By providing these services, DeepWise aims to support healthcare providers in both domestic and international markets in their efforts to detect and treat diseases effectively.

TBSTest

Series D in 2024
TBSTest Technology is a developer and manufacturer of automatic test equipment for integrated circuits, specializing in ultra-large-scale integrated circuit testing.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Beijing, China, with additional offices in Xi’an and Shanghai, as well as Suwon, South Korea, the company provides a comprehensive range of products, including test boards, software solutions, and memory systems. TBSTest Technology also offers pre-sales and after-sales support for its equipment, accessories, and software systems, along with application development projects. The company serves a diverse clientele, including clients engaged in integrated circuit design and production, as well as scientific research institutions and educational establishments.

Chaitin Tech

Venture Round in 2024
Beijing Chaitin Tech Co., Ltd. is a technology-oriented security company focused on addressing Internet security challenges. With a highly skilled research and development team, Chaitin Tech specializes in creating customized security products and services aimed at enhancing the security capabilities of enterprises. The company develops innovative web application security solutions that protect critical assets from evolving cyber threats. By leveraging advanced technologies and methods, Chaitin Tech strives to improve domestic security levels while aligning with global standards in cybersecurity.

Leapstack

Series C in 2023
Leapstack is an insurance technology company based in Shanghai, with additional offices in Beijing and Nanjing. Founded in February 2016, it focuses on developing big data artificial intelligence solutions tailored for commercial insurance companies and social security management agencies. The company's platform enhances the insurance claims process by offering services such as risk control monitoring, post-medical reimbursement, anti-fraud measures, and compliance identification. By addressing inefficiencies in the industry, Leapstack aims to improve operational effectiveness and provide comprehensive data analysis and management tools for its clients.

Shuhai Supply Chain

Series B in 2022
Shuhai Supply Chain Logistics is a leading supply chain service provider based in Beijing, China, established in June 2011. The company specializes in offering comprehensive supply chain solutions tailored for the food industry, particularly catering businesses. Its services encompass sales, procurement, production, quality assurance, warehousing, and transportation, ensuring that restaurant owners receive fresh and high-quality ingredients. Shuhai operates a nationwide modern cold chain logistics network and food processing plants, which positions it as a benchmark enterprise in the supply chain sector, recognized by both industry authorities and customers for its commitment to quality and reliability.

Zshield

Series C in 2022
Zshield Inc. is a Beijing-based company specializing in cyberspace data security and big data business risk management. Established in 2014, it is recognized as the first high-tech firm in China to leverage big data technologies in addressing emerging information security vulnerabilities. Zshield develops advanced integrated information security solutions that utilize lightweight virtualization, deep learning, and big data analysis to provide effective monitoring of server and terminal security. Its offerings include a comprehensive information security platform and the AndunTM ZS-ISP, which supports both government and enterprise clients in navigating the complexities of modern computing environments, including cloud computing and mobile applications. As traditional security measures struggle to cope with new threats, Zshield's innovative approach aims to fortify businesses against the evolving landscape of information security challenges.

River Security

Series C in 2021
River Security specializes in advanced cybersecurity solutions, focusing on fraud risk protection and dynamic application security. Established in 2012 with headquarters in Shanghai, Beijing, and Shenzhen, the company has developed innovative technologies that enhance the security of corporate website applications and safeguard business data. Its dynamic security bot-gate product utilizes a unique approach to predict server behavior by transforming the underlying code of web pages, allowing for more efficient and timely defenses against various modern cyber attacks. This technology represents a significant departure from traditional security methods, enabling businesses to reduce deployment and operational costs while improving overall security effectiveness.

XSKY Data Technology

Series E in 2021
XSKY Data Technology, based in Beijing, specializes in software-defined infrastructure products and services. It offers a range of storage solutions, including XCBS (cloud), XEBS (block), XEUS (unified), XEOS (object), and XEDP (unified data platform), catering to diverse sectors such as finance, enterprise, telecom, energy, and government. XSKY is a significant contributor to the open-source Ceph storage system, ranking top 3 globally. It partners with leading tech companies like Intel and Samsung, providing scalable, cost-effective storage solutions tailored for enterprise data center innovation.

GKHT Medical Technology

Series C in 2019
Guoke Hengtai (Beijing) Medical Technology Co., Ltd., established in February 2013, is a company based in the Yizhuang Economic and Technological Development Zone of Beijing. It operates under the umbrella of Oriental Science and Technology Holding Group Co., Ltd., a subsidiary of the State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ission of the Chinese Academy of Sciences. The company specializes in the distribution and direct sales of medical devices, offering a range of professional services, including warehousing logistics, distribution channel management, and hospital SPD operation management. Since its inception, Guoke Hengtai has experienced significant growth, achieving a compound annual growth rate exceeding 50% over four years and embarking on an initial public offering journey in 2017.

Zongmu

Series C in 2019
Zongmu Technology Co. Ltd, established in 2013, is a Shanghai-based company specializing in automotive industry solutions and integration services. It operates research and development centers in Beijing and Shenzhen. Zongmu is renowned for its SurroundView ADAS (Advanced Driving Assistance System), which has been successfully implemented in major OEM automotive markets. The company has formed strategic partnerships with several OEM car manufacturers and tier-1 suppliers, solidifying its position as the leading SurroundView ADAS solution provider in the Chinese domestic market.

New Horizon Health

Series C in 2019
New Horizon Health is a biotechnology company based in Hangzhou, China, with an additional office in Beijing, specializing in the development of innovative technologies for early cancer detection and screening. Founded in 2015, the company primarily focuses on gastrointestinal cancers, offering products such as the ColoClear and Pupu Tube, which utilize fecal gene analysis (FIT-DNA) technology for colorectal cancer screening. These products enable users to conduct in-home tests, allowing for the early detection of colon cancer and precancerous lesions that may not be identified through traditional blood tests. New Horizon Health aims to reduce cancer morbidity and mortality rates by promoting accessible and efficient health services, leveraging big data and artificial intelligence in its screening technologies. The company's commitment to early cancer screening reflects its mission to enhance public health by facilitating widespread access to vital diagnostic tools.

Enjoy Dental Clinic

Series B in 2018
Enjoy Dental Clinic is a prominent dental care provider based in Beijing, China, established in 2007. It operates as a large-scale dental chain that integrates medical treatment, scientific research, education, and administrative functions. The clinic adheres to standardized practices in oral health treatment, employing advanced techniques such as 3D printing, digital-guided dental implants, and oral digital CT scanning. Additionally, Enjoy Dental Clinic prioritizes aseptic procedures and individualized care, utilizing a "one person, one machine" approach to ensure safety and hygiene. The clinic also offers franchising services, facilitating dental training and clinic development for aspiring dentists, thereby contributing to the growth of dental care expertise in the region.

Youdao

Series A in 2018
Youdao, Inc. is an internet technology company based in Hangzhou, China, dedicated to providing online services focused on content, community, communication, and commerce. Founded in 2006, the company specializes in developing learning content, applications, and solutions tailored for a diverse range of users, including preschoolers, K-12 students, college students, and adult learners. Its offerings include the Youdao Dictionary, Youdao Cloudnote, and various online dictionary and translation tools. The company also markets smart devices such as the Youdao Smart Pen and Youdao Pocket Translator. Youdao's primary revenue source comes from its Learning services segment, which encompasses online courses like Youdao Premium Courses and NetEase Cloud Classroom. Additionally, the company provides online marketing services and technical support, operating as a subsidiary of NetEase, Inc.

Zuoyebang

Series C in 2017
Zuoyebang is an online education startup based in Beijing, China, founded in 2014 by Hou Jianbin. The company focuses on providing educational products and services for primary and high school students, utilizing artificial intelligence to enhance learning experiences. Its platform allows students to upload homework questions and seek answers, making it easier for them to tackle study-related challenges. In addition to homework assistance, Zuoyebang offers online courses, live lessons, and evaluations for students from kindergarten through 12th grade. The company has gained significant backing from prominent investors, including Baidu, Alibaba Group, Tiger Global Management, SoftBank Vision Fund, Sequoia Capital China, and FountainVest Partners.

Pharmaron

Private Equity Round in 2015
Pharmaron Beijing Co Ltd is a research and development service provider in the life sciences sector, specializing in a comprehensive range of services for drug discovery, preclinical, and clinical development. The company supports various therapeutic modalities, including small molecules, biologics, and cell and gene therapies. Pharmaron's offerings encompass laboratory chemistry, biosciences, drug metabolism and pharmacokinetics (DMPK), pharmacology, drug safety assessments, and clinical development services. Its operations are divided into several segments, with laboratory services generating the highest revenue. By providing these essential services, Pharmaron plays a crucial role in advancing the drug development process for its clients.

Reach Surgical

Venture Round in 2013
Reach Surgical is a manufacturer of surgical instruments and medical equipment, established in 2005 as a foreign-owned enterprise in China. The company focuses on integrating research and development with production and sales, offering advanced solutions for minimally invasive surgeries. Its product range includes open series staplers and endoscopic staplers designed for thoracic and general surgery procedures. All products have received approvals from the US FDA and the EU CE, ensuring compliance with high industry standards. Reach Surgical operates three research and development centers located in Cincinnati, USA, and in Beijing and Shanghai, China, underscoring its commitment to innovation and improving surgical operation efficiency for clinical surgeons worldwide.

Uxin

Series A in 2013
Uxin Limited is a Beijing-based investment holding company that operates a used car e-commerce platform in China. Founded in 2011, Uxin provides a comprehensive suite of services through its Uxin Used Car and Uxin Auction applications. The Uxin Used Car platform offers consumers personalized car recommendations, financing options, title transfer, delivery, insurance referrals, and warranties. Meanwhile, Uxin Auction caters to business buyers by facilitating vehicle sourcing through online auctions. Additionally, Uxin supports used car transactions and connects buyers with third-party financing partners for their purchases. The company aims to streamline the used car buying process and enhance the overall customer experience in the automotive market.

Happy Elements

Series B in 2011
Happy Elements is a prominent interactive entertainment company based in Beijing, founded in 2009. With nearly 600 employees and additional offices and R&D centers in Shanghai, Tokyo, Kyoto, and San Francisco, the company specializes in mobile gaming, comics and animation, and virtual idols. It has garnered a significant user base, boasting over 150 million monthly active users. Happy Elements is recognized for its successful titles such as "Anipop," which is the leading casual game in China, and "Ensemble Star!," a popular male idol game and virtual idol group in Japan. The company is currently focused on integrating advanced AI technology into its gaming products to enhance user experience and fulfill its mission of bringing happiness to users worldwide.

AutoNavi

Series A in 2006
AutoNavi Holdings Limited is a Chinese company based in Beijing that specializes in digital map content and navigation solutions. It provides a comprehensive mobile and internet location-based service platform, catering to both business and consumer needs. The company's offerings include automotive navigation, mobile location services, taxi booking, bike sharing, and real-time traffic updates, all tailored for the Chinese market. AutoNavi's proprietary technology and extensive digital map database enable it to deliver integrated navigation solutions across various sectors, including public services and enterprise applications. The company has formed strategic alliances with prominent organizations such as TomTom Global Content, SINA, and Alibaba Group, enhancing its service capabilities.
